@import"https://fonts.googleapis.com/css2?family=Open+Sans:wght@300;400;500;600;700&family=Poppins:wght@400;500;600;700&display=swap";:root{color-scheme:dark;font-family:Open Sans,sans-serif}html{scroll-behavior:smooth}h1,h2,h3,h4,h5,h6,.font-bold{font-family:Poppins,sans-serif}a,button{cursor:pointer}a:focus-visible,button:focus-visible,input:focus-visible,textarea:focus-visible{outline:2px solid #0EA5E9;outline-offset:4px}.hero-gradient{background:linear-gradient(135deg,rgba(15,23,42,.95) 0%,rgba(6,78,59,.85) 100%)}.card-hover{transition:transform .25s ease,box-shadow .25s ease,border-color .25s ease}.card-hover:hover{transform:translateY(-6px);box-shadow:0 25px 35px -15px #00000073}.process-step:before{content:"";position:absolute;top:0;left:24px;height:100%;width:2px;background:#10B981;z-index:0}.process-step:last-child:before{display:none}.testimonial-card{background:linear-gradient(145deg,#111827 0%,#0f172a 100%);transition:transform .25s ease,box-shadow .25s ease}.testimonial-card:hover{transform:translateY(-4px);box-shadow:0 20px 40px -18px #10b98159}.btn-focus-ring:focus-visible{outline:2px solid #22c55e;outline-offset:4px}.fi{border-radius:2px;box-shadow:0 0 1px #00000080}
